Не могу прыгнуть в закрытие - PullRequest
0 голосов
/ 15 января 2020

Я пытаюсь зарегистрироваться, но мой код не входит в закрытие

FireStoreManager.shared.register(user: user, password: password) { [weak self] result, error -> Void in
            if error != nil {
                guard let uid = result?.user.uid else {
                    print("Not user registed")
                    return
                }
            } else {
                completion(result, error)
                self?.registData(user: user, password: password, uid: result?.user.uid ?? "", fullname: fullname)
            }
        }
    }

1 Ответ

0 голосов
/ 15 января 2020

У вас неправильный синтаксис списка захвата. Ваша верхняя строка должна выглядеть так:

FireStoreManager.shared.register(user: user, password: password) { [weak self] (result, error) in
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...